DDR FESTIVAL -Dance Dance Revolution- is a music video game developed and published by Konami and released in 2004 for the PlayStation 2 in Japan only.
General Information / Changes[]
- Released the same day as Dance Dance Revolution ULTRAMIX2.
- Coincidentally, several pieces of background music from ULTRAMIX are re-used in DDR FESTIVAL -Dance Dance Revolution- and new background music is shared with Dance Dance Revolution ULTRAMIX2.
- First "catch up" Japanese Dance Dance Revolution title. Most of the song list consists of new KONAMI originals from Dance Dance Revolution ULTRAMIX and Dance Dance Revolution EXTREME CS (North America), along with a few new licenses, some of the licenses from Dance Dance Revolution EXTREME CS (North America), some old KONAMI original Dance Dance Revolution songs, and two new KONAMI originals.
- Song list as a result has a large emphasis on BEMANI crossovers than most Japanese CS Dance Dance Revolution releases. Of the 55 KONAMI originals in DDR FESTIVAL, only 19 are original Dance Dance Revolution songs/original remixes.
- Interface is taken directly from EXTREME CS (America), though licenses, default KONAMI originals, and hidden songs are all colored differently from one another unlike in that game.
- It also uses the same scoring system as EXTREME CS (America) (full combo required to AA, and songs are worth 70% possible score before bonus points).
- Most of the ULTRAMIX songs have brand-new HEAVY charts on Single (INSERTiON(Machine Gun Kelly Mix) got a new Single BASIC chart only). None of them have BEGINNER charts.
- Double charts remain untouched, except for ABSOLUTE (Cuff -N- Stuff it Mix), which got a new Double HEAVY chart.
- Keep Ya Body Movin' and There 4 you are the only ULTRAMIX songs that did not receive new charts.
- First Japanese PlayStation 2 Dance Dance Revolution release compatible with Sony's EyeToy accessory, which can be used to play mini-games and exclusive modes.
- None of the songs included in DDR FESTIVAL -Dance Dance Revolution- feature CHALLENGE charts in GAME MODE.
- 桜's CHALLENGE charts are in the game, but they're only playable in the Adrenaline Course.
- BeForU members Riyu Kosaka and Noria Shiraishi appear on the back cover of the DDR FESTIVAL -Dance Dance Revolution- box, as well as in screenshots on the official site advertising the new EyeToy games.
- Both also appear on a short video shown on the attract mode, demonstrating the aforementioned EyeToy features and minigames.
- Electro Tuned(the SubS mix) uses its original background and its DDRMAX -Dance Dance Revolution- banner, despite the song receiving a new set of graphics in Dancing Stage EuroMIX2.
- Can unlock everything in Dance Dance Revolution Party Collection through System Data Support.
- Total songs: 66
